Hanover County, VA mailboxes and post offices

There are 23 United States Postal Service post boxes and offices available to the public in Hanover County. You can use any one of these locations to mail your letter or package via USPS. For additional collection boxes in neighboring communities, see the list of mailboxes in Virginia.

Post Offices and Mailboxes in Virginia

Where to buy postage stamps in Hanover County, VA

13228 Hanover Courthouse Rd
Directions
Public Collection Box
2746 Maidens Loop
Directions
Public Collection Box
200 Concourse Blvd
Directions
Public Collection Box
7336 Bell Creek Rd
Directions
Public Collection Box
8050 Mechanicsville Tnpk
Directions
Public Collection Box
7047 Mechanicsville Tnpk
Directions
Public Collection Box
7484 Lee Davis Rd
Directions
Public Collection Box
8266 Atlee Rd
Directions
Public Collection Box
201 N Washington Hwy
Directions
Public Collection Box
10487 Lakeridge Pkwy
Directions
Public Collection Box
10030 Sliding Hill Rd
Directions
Public Collection Box
10101 Brook Rd
Directions
Public Collection Box
1031 Technology Park Dr
Directions